When making a property landscape, one of the most essential action is to put an intend on paper. Developing a master strategy will certainly save you time and cash and is more probable to cause a successful style. A master strategy is developed with the 'design process': a detailed technique that takes into consideration the environmental conditions, your needs, and the elements and principles of style.


The 9-Minute Rule for Landscapers


The five steps of the style procedure include: 1) conducting a site inventory and evaluation, 2) establishing your demands, 3) developing useful representations, 4) creating conceptual style strategies, and 5) attracting a final design strategy. The initial three steps develop the visual, practical, and horticultural requirements for the design. The last 2 actions then apply those needs to the production of the last landscape plan.

The kind of dirt determines the nutrients and dampness available to the plants. It is constantly best to use plants that will grow in the existing dirt. Soil can be changed, modification is often expensive and the majority of times ineffective. Existing greenery can give clues to the soil type. Where plants expand well, keep in mind the soil conditions and utilize plants with comparable expanding needs.


Top Guidelines Of Landscapers


Topography and drainage should also be kept in mind and all drain issues remedied in the recommended layout. A good design will move water away from your house and re-route it to other areas of the yard. Environment problems start with temperature: plants should be able to endure the average high and, most significantly, the ordinary low temperature levels for the region.




Sun/shade patterns, the quantity and length of direct exposure to sunlight or shade (Number 1), create microclimates (sometimes called microhabitats). Recording website problems and existing plants on a base map will expose the location of microclimates in the yard. Plants usually come under 1 or 2 of four microclimate categories-full sunlight, partial color, shade, and deep color.


Utilities such as power lines, septic storage tanks, below ground energies and roof overhangs identify plant place. Make use of a surveyor's plat of your residential or commercial property for the borders and area of your home.


Budget concerns include the materials, preliminary setup prices and the on-going upkeep prices. Determine if you wish to open your backyard, close your lawn, or a little of both, to these sights. In other words, do you desire the garden to enclose the space around you and associate mostly to your home, or do you want the yard to open sights and look outside, connecting to the surroundings? This will certainly give you a starting indicate think of a motif.




This is called "local color", which indicates it fits with the surroundings. There are both form themes and style themes. Every garden ought to have a type style, but not all gardens have a style motif. Numerous domestic gardens have no particular design other than to blend with the house by repeating information from the style such as products, shade, and type.


In a type style the company and form of the rooms in the yard is based either on the shape of the house, the form of the areas between your house and the residential property borders, or a favorite form of the home owner. The kind style figures out the shape and organization (the layout) of the rooms and the links between them.

Style is normally the primary resource of a motif, but motifs can likewise represent a time, a society, a location, or a sensation, such as peacefulness or calmness. The benefit to utilizing a traditional design theme is the well-known set of kinds and aspects have traditionally functioned news well with each other and endured the test of time.


Official building and garden designs that can be made use of for inspiration consist of French, Spanish, Italian, and Center Eastern. Much less formal designs consist of Oriental, English, and American. Design styles can additionally use to the growing strategy and may include tropical, desert, meadow, woodland, marsh, or seaside plantings. Styles can be as easy as a shade mix or plants with a distinctive personality- such as grasses-used repeatedly in the make-up.
